| 正面描述 |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ust of Emperor Elagabalus facing right, depicted frontally with visible paludamentum and scale armour. The effigy is rendered in the provincial Alexandrian style with characteristic bold relief. A circular Greek legend surrounds the portrait field, reading Α ΚΑΙϹΑΡ ΜΑ ΑΥΡ ΑΝΤωΝΙΝΟϹ ΕΥϹΕΒ, identifying the emperor by his imperial titulature. |

| 背面描述 | Jugate busts of Nilus and Euthenia facing right, with Nilus depicted as a mature bearded male wearing a lotus crown and Euthenia as a draped female figure. A cornucopia appears to the left of the conjoined busts, symbolising the fertility and abundance of the Nile. The regnal year date L Ε (Year 5) appears in the right field, consistent with the fifth year of Elagabalus's reign in the Alexandrian dating system. |
